The field experiment was carried out during rabi season 2022 at the Crop Research Farm, Department of Agronomy, Naini Agricultural Institute, Sam Higginbottom University of Agriculture, Technology and Sciences, Prayagraj (U.P.) India. The experiment was laid out in Randomized Block Design with ten treatments replicated thrice. The treatment combinations are T1:Azotobacter 25g + Zinc 0.1% (30 DAS and 50 DAS) T2:Azotobacter 25g + Zinc 0.3% (30 DAS and 50 DAS) T3: Azotobacter 25g + Zinc 0.5% (30 DAS and 50 DAS) T4:Azospirillum 25g + Zinc 0.1% (30 DAS and 50 DAS) T5:Azospirillum 25g + Zinc 0.3% (30 DAS and 50 DAS) T6:Azospirillum 25g + Zinc 0.5% (30 DAS and 50 DAS) T7:Azotobacter + Azospirillum 25g +Zinc 0.1% (30 DAS and 50DAS). T8:Azotobacter + Azospirillum 25g +Zinc 0.3% (30 DAS and 50 DAS) T9:Azotobacter+ Azospirillum 25g +Zinc 0.5% (30 DAS and 50 DAS), T10: Control (RDF-80-40-40 NPK kg/ha) are used. Results obtained that the higher plant height (205.06 cm), higher plant dry weight (78.17 g/plant), higher crop growth rate (37.6 g/m2 /day), higher ear head length (24.74 cm), higher grains/ear head (2212.69), higher test weight (10.29 gm), higher grain yield (34.16 q/ha) and higher stover yield (69.00 q/ha) were significantly influenced with application of Azotobacter+ Azospirillum 25g +Zinc 0.5% (30 DAS and 50 DAS). Higher gross returns (INR 96553.67/ha), higher net returns (INR 67523.67/ha) and higher B:C ratio (2.03) were also recorded in treatment-9 (Azotobacter+ Azospirillum 25g +Zinc 0.5% (30 DAS and 50 DAS).
